Our client is seeking a Network Engineer to be based in their London Office. This is a fantastic opportunity for an entrepreneurial minded, excellence driven individual to drive customer growth at one of the most innovative telecoms companies in the UK.The role of the Network Engineer will be to own the full project lifecycle, providing low level design (LLD) and configuration, as well as BAU operational support in a full multi-vendor environment - routers and switches.The Responsibilities:Assisting with Business as Usual activities to support day to day network operations in a ISP environment.Extensive experience in running a full project lifecycle.CCNA/CCNP/JNCIA level certification required.Able to work in a high tempo environment, with autonomy.Resolving Level 1 - 3 issues. Creating and/or updating case notes on service incident tickets.Network operation, including, hands on experience with switches, routers, hubs, servers, firewalls, wireless, TCP/IP, ONT,UDP, IPT VoIP, QoS, MPLS, QinQ.The ideal candidate for the Network Engineer will be comfortable working with Huawei/Cisco/Juniper/HP routers, switches on GPON and P2P.Cisco CCNA/CCNP level or Juniper JNCIS or JNCIP certified.Any experience in Network Automation or coding would also be beneficial, but not essential.Excellent communication skills required.Creating network diagrams, SOWs, HLD, LLDs skills desirable.Able to interact with other members of the Business on joint projects.Knowledge of Business IT, i.e. home networks, servers, email, Wi-Fi access points, Ethernet over power lines etc.Strong multitasking & problem solving abilities. Excellent communication, customer handling and inter-personal skills, via phone, face to face and other remote access methods.Strong planning, organising and prioritising abilities.Customer focused.Flexible to cope with change, be proactive and adapt quickly to a developing type of service delivery.Flexible to visit the datacentre as and when needed.Good documentation of projects or other issues is essential.Index Recruitment is acting as an Employment Agency in relation to this vacancy."Due to the high volume of applications we currently receive, we are unable to respond to all candidates.
